Re: [Netconf] YANG Doctor question: empty mandatory choice?

Juergen Schoenwaelder <j.schoenwaelder@jacobs-university.de> Tue, 31 July 2018 17:55 UTC

Return-Path: <j.schoenwaelder@jacobs-university.de>
X-Original-To: netconf@ietfa.amsl.com
Delivered-To: netconf@ietfa.amsl.com
Received: from localhost (localhost [127.0.0.1]) by ietfa.amsl.com (Postfix) with ESMTP id 9BB88130E60 for <netconf@ietfa.amsl.com>; Tue, 31 Jul 2018 10:55:43 -0700 (PDT)
X-Virus-Scanned: amavisd-new at amsl.com
X-Spam-Flag: NO
X-Spam-Score: 0
X-Spam-Level:
X-Spam-Status: No, score=0 tagged_above=-999 required=5 tests=[none] autolearn=unavailable autolearn_force=no
Received: from mail.ietf.org ([4.31.198.44]) by localhost (ietfa.amsl.com [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id 8CUweFEdoItt for <netconf@ietfa.amsl.com>; Tue, 31 Jul 2018 10:55:40 -0700 (PDT)
Received: from anna.localdomain (anna.eecs.jacobs-university.de [IPv6:2001:638:709:5::7]) by ietfa.amsl.com (Postfix) with ESMTP id 3E5D91292AD for <netconf@ietf.org>; Tue, 31 Jul 2018 10:55:40 -0700 (PDT)
Received: by anna.localdomain (Postfix, from userid 501) id 989DE23A587D; Tue, 31 Jul 2018 19:55:39 +0200 (CEST)
Date: Tue, 31 Jul 2018 19:55:38 +0200
From: Juergen Schoenwaelder <j.schoenwaelder@jacobs-university.de>
To: Kent Watsen <kwatsen@juniper.net>
Cc: Martin Bjorklund <mbj@tail-f.com>, "evoit=40cisco.com@dmarc.ietf.org" <evoit=40cisco.com@dmarc.ietf.org>, "netconf@ietf.org" <netconf@ietf.org>
Message-ID: <20180731175538.tsdcuea4lbdl7fui@anna.jacobs.jacobs-university.de>
Reply-To: Juergen Schoenwaelder <j.schoenwaelder@jacobs-university.de>
Mail-Followup-To: Kent Watsen <kwatsen@juniper.net>, Martin Bjorklund <mbj@tail-f.com>, "evoit=40cisco.com@dmarc.ietf.org" <evoit=40cisco.com@dmarc.ietf.org>, "netconf@ietf.org" <netconf@ietf.org>
References: <44B0A74E-CCF0-4E9B-846A-1F46E90AEB5E@juniper.net>
MIME-Version: 1.0
Content-Type: text/plain; charset="us-ascii"
Content-Disposition: inline
In-Reply-To: <44B0A74E-CCF0-4E9B-846A-1F46E90AEB5E@juniper.net>
User-Agent: NeoMutt/20180716
Archived-At: <https://mailarchive.ietf.org/arch/msg/netconf/jaraB1j0RTg695oVOPXOPni66Mo>
Subject: Re: [Netconf] YANG Doctor question: empty mandatory choice?
X-BeenThere: netconf@ietf.org
X-Mailman-Version: 2.1.27
Precedence: list
List-Id: Network Configuration WG mailing list <netconf.ietf.org>
List-Unsubscribe: <https://www.ietf.org/mailman/options/netconf>, <mailto:netconf-request@ietf.org?subject=unsubscribe>
List-Archive: <https://mailarchive.ietf.org/arch/browse/netconf/>
List-Post: <mailto:netconf@ietf.org>
List-Help: <mailto:netconf-request@ietf.org?subject=help>
List-Subscribe: <https://www.ietf.org/mailman/listinfo/netconf>, <mailto:netconf-request@ietf.org?subject=subscribe>
X-List-Received-Date: Tue, 31 Jul 2018 17:55:44 -0000

On Mon, Jul 30, 2018 at 08:44:15PM +0000, Kent Watsen wrote:
> 
> In the case of RESTCONF, we could update the ietf-restconf-client and
> ietf-restconf-server models to include an "encodings" leaf-list, to 
> configure the RESTCONF server which encodings it should support.

RESTCONF uses SSE for notification delivery. What you have in mind is
likely the HTTP/2 push transport defined in
draft-ietf-netconf-restconf-notif which I think should not be called
RESTCONF just because it uses some version of HTTP.

/js

-- 
Juergen Schoenwaelder           Jacobs University Bremen gGmbH
Phone: +49 421 200 3587         Campus Ring 1 | 28759 Bremen | Germany
Fax:   +49 421 200 3103         <https://www.jacobs-university.de/>